What the Data Highlights

Its 1/5 overall CMS rating is below the Pennsylvania average of 3.0/5.
Its 2/5 health inspection rating is below the Pennsylvania average of 2.8/5.
Reported nursing time is 3.02 hours per resident per day, below the state average of 3.89.
Reported RN time is 0.48 hours per resident per day, below the state average of 0.79.

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center is a 1-star Medicare and Medicaid certified nursing home in Troy, Pennsylvania with 200 certified beds. It has been operating since 1983. Its overall CMS rating is 1 out of 5.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the CMS rating for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center?▾
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center has an overall CMS rating of 1 out of 5 stars, with a health inspection rating of 2/5, staffing rating of 1/5, and quality measures rating of 4/5. This facility is rated below average.
How much does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center cost per month?▾
While individual facility pricing is not publicly available, the median nursing home cost in Pennsylvania is $10,981/month for a semi-private room and $11,932/month for a private room (Genworth/CareScout 2024).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center participates in Medicare and Medicaid, which may cover some or all costs depending on eligibility.
Has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center had any health inspection violations?▾
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center had 13 deficiency citations in its most recent health inspection (Dec 12, 2025). The current CMS dataset records no fines for this facility.
What are the staffing levels at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center?▾
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center provides 3.02 total nursing staff hours per resident per day, including 0.48 RN hours, 0.77 LPN hours, and 1.76 nurse aide hours. The total staff turnover rate is 59.6%.
How many beds does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center have?▾
Bradford Hills Nursing & Rehabilitation Center has 200 certified beds with an average of 136.6 residents per day, resulting in approximately 68% occupancy. The facility is For profit - Corporation owned and is part of the Allaire Health Services chain.
